Well for a list of reasons I was not able to do my own work on the "Jag" who needed a new shoe. There is a realatively new dealer close by (10.min) so before I recommend them I thought I would give them a try. I called and they said come on in and they would take care of me while I waited. I had my own tires and brakes, just in case 33,000 miles on them, and headed on over. Kevin, a very capable young Can Am tech check her over and said I had 30% left on the brakes on the rear and the fronts were still fine. So I said go ahead and change the tire and brakes and within and hour and a half he had me out the door. Sum total $165.00. Seems fair I would have charged myself more just for bringing my own parts...:roflblack::roflblack: Tony, the service manager was very helpful and a great guy to talk to. So now I can say this is a good place to go and bike night is there with bacon burger....:yes:
